<p>8 minutes remained in the 4th, and Mona Shores had a commanding 27-9 lead. 4 minutes later, Rockford was leading 31-27.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Let's explore how it all happened.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:heading -->
<h2>Clear Waters and Smooth 1st-Half Sailing</h2>
<!-- /wp:heading -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>From the opening kickoff, Mona Shores looked like the better team. Both teams traded possessions a few times, but Mona Shores asserted their dominance at the line of scrimmage and ran a balanced rushing attack, winning time of possession, wearing out the defense, and getting the ball to their playmakers. </p>

<p>Throughout the entire 1st-half, Rockford looked flat, and Mona Shores looked confident and prepared. The Sailor offense was doing their jobs and doing it well. Despite a late TD from [player_tooltip player_id='286467' first='Brody' last='Thompson'], Rockford went into the locker room embarrassed. There was absolutely no energy in the air.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:heading -->
<h2>A Physical 3rd-Quarter</h2>
<!-- /wp:heading -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Looking back at the 3rd Quarter, Mona Shores still commanded the game, while Rockford showed some signs of life.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>With 5:28 to go in the 3rd, [player_tooltip player_id='243093' first='KeWaun' last='Farnum'] pushed the Sailor lead to 27-7.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Rockford then got the ball back and started driving down the field. The Rams were finally starting to heat up, and [player_tooltip player_id='232200' first='Mac' last='VandenHout'] looked solid. Then, from the Shores 20-yard line, VandenHout fired a pass that was then tipped and intercepted by Trent Rosenthal.</p>

<p>At this point, I didn't have much hope for Rockford. It would have been easy for them to throw in the towel right here, but they didn't.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Rockford then forced a safety, making it 27-9. Then, the Sailor offense stalled ocnce more, turning it over on downs. </p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:heading -->
<h2>A 4th-Quarter Stampede </h2>
<!-- /wp:heading -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>(You must listen to Return of the Mack while reading this)</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>After forcing a Mona Shores punt, Rockford drove down the field and capped off the drive with a 21-yard [player_tooltip player_id='232200' first='Mac' last='VandenHout'] scramble. A successful 2-point conversion made it 27-17. It was at this point where I saw a little confidence and swagger from Mac and the offense. I could tell something was brewing.</p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Shores got the football back, and that's when Rockford Senior Captian [player_tooltip player_id='394475' first='Rick' last='Beison'] came up with a game-changing interception giving his offense the ball with incredible field position. </p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='232201' first='Alex' last='McLean'] comes up clutch, smoking [player_tooltip player_id='409663' first='Jaylen' last='Vinton'] in coverage while [player_tooltip player_id='232200' first='Mac' last='VandenHout'] delivers the TD strike. It was suddenly a 27-24 game with 6:12 remaining, and the Rockford sideline looked obsessively focused and locked in. </p>
